Transaction

98d55738900c88c28c492eb64d2d9341fbe285759df746305f9322393169efca

Summary

In Block1723238
TimeMon, 01 Apr 2019 03:13:07 UTC
Total Input2568.420135 PIV
Total Output2573.420135 PIV
Fees0 PIV

Details

Fee: 0 PIV
3521815 Confirmations2573.420135 PIV
Raw Transaction